During the 3 point Trademark Attorney Registerability Review a trademark Attorney will review three aspects relating to the registerability of your trademark:
Check 1 - Capable of distinguishing
Your trademark must be capable of distinguishing. In other words, if your trademark describes your goods or services, the trademark comprises a sign that other traders are likely to use in the course of their business.
During this step, a trademark Attorney will advise on whether your trademark is capable of distinguishing and suggest amendments to your mark if necessary.
Check 2 - Conflicting with other marks
If your trademark is the same or similar to other live trademarks in the trademarks register for the same or similar goods and services, your trademark may be rejected.
During this step, a trademark Attorney will perform a supplemental trademark (in addition to the search already conducted by the Trademarkify filing software) search to identify any potentially conflicting trademarks and suggest amendments to your mark if necessary.
Check 3 - Scope of goods and services
Trademarks are registered in respect of one or more goods and services. The more goods and services, the greater the scope of protection. However, the more goods and services, the greater the chance of your trademark conflicting with other trademarks during examination.
During this step, a trademark Attorney will advise on the scope of your goods and services and suggest amendments if necessary
